Proven Strategies to Build a Personalized Recommendation System for Multi-City Car Rentals
1. Harness Collaborative Filtering to Decode Customer Behavior Patterns
Collaborative filtering analyzes rental histories and customer interactions to recommend vehicles favored by users with similar preferences. This data-driven approach captures implicit tastes without requiring explicit input.
- Example: If customers who rent SUVs in New York often choose hybrid cars in San Francisco, the system can recommend hybrids to similar profiles visiting either city, enabling cross-market personalization.
2. Leverage Content-Based Filtering Focused on Vehicle Features and Customer Profiles
Content-based filtering matches vehicle attributes—such as fuel type, size, transmission, and luxury level—to explicit customer preferences or past rentals. This method supports personalized suggestions even for new users with limited rental history.
- Example: A customer preferring compact, fuel-efficient cars will consistently receive recommendations aligned with those specifications regardless of prior rentals.
3. Develop Hybrid Models Combining Collaborative, Content-Based, and Contextual Data
Hybrid models integrate collaborative and content-based filtering with real-time contextual data such as city-specific trends, local events, and seasonality. This fusion delivers more accurate and relevant recommendations.
- Example: During a major conference, the system prioritizes premium sedans favored by business travelers, blending customer preference with event-driven demand.
4. Integrate Real-Time Data for Dynamic, Context-Aware Personalization
Incorporate live information such as vehicle availability, pricing fluctuations, and local events to adjust recommendations instantly. This ensures relevance and maximizes booking opportunities by responding to supply and demand shifts.
- Example: If SUVs are in short supply in a city due to a demand spike, the system suggests alternative vehicle classes to avoid lost bookings.
5. Segment Markets and Customers to Tailor Recommendations Precisely
Detailed customer and market segmentation allows the system to reflect local preferences, traffic conditions, and rental purposes (business vs. leisure). This granularity enhances recommendation relevance.
- Example: Leisure travelers in coastal cities receive convertible suggestions, while business travelers in financial hubs are recommended premium sedans.

8. Employ A/B Testing to Evaluate and Improve Recommendation Algorithms
Systematically test different recommendation strategies and user interfaces across markets to identify the most effective approaches and iterate rapidly.
- Example: Comparing pure collaborative filtering against hybrid models in a test city to measure impact on booking rates and customer satisfaction.
Step-by-Step Implementation Guide for Each Recommendation Strategy
1. Collaborative Filtering: From Data to Actionable Recommendations
- Data Required: Comprehensive rental histories, customer ratings, and booking patterns across all cities.
- Implementation Steps:
- Construct a user-vehicle interaction matrix capturing rentals and preferences.
- Calculate similarity metrics (e.g., cosine similarity, Pearson correlation) between users.
- Recommend vehicles favored by users with similar profiles.
- Tools: Apache Mahout and TensorFlow Recommenders provide scalable, open-source frameworks for collaborative filtering.
- Business Impact: Identifies latent customer preferences, enhancing recommendation relevance without explicit input.
2. Content-Based Filtering: Matching Vehicle Features to Customer Profiles
- Data Required: Detailed vehicle attributes (type, transmission, fuel efficiency, price) and explicit customer preferences.
- Implementation Steps:
- Build customer profiles based on past rentals and stated preferences.
- Match these profiles against vehicle features using feature vectors.
- Rank vehicles by relevance scores to generate personalized recommendations.
- Tools: Elasticsearch supports efficient attribute-based search and ranking; Scikit-learn facilitates feature matching and ranking.
- Business Impact: Enables personalized recommendations for new customers or those with limited rental history.
3. Hybrid Models: Combining Data Sources for Enhanced Accuracy
- Data Required: Outputs from collaborative and content-based filtering plus contextual data such as city trends, time, and local events.
- Implementation Steps:
- Fuse recommendation scores using weighted averages or machine learning models (e.g., matrix factorization).
- Tune weights and parameters through cross-validation and A/B testing.
- Tools: Scikit-learn and Microsoft Recommenders offer flexible frameworks to develop and optimize hybrid models.
- Business Impact: Balances personalization with context-awareness, driving higher booking conversions.
4. Real-Time Personalization: Adapting Recommendations to Market Dynamics
- Data Required: Live vehicle inventory, pricing updates, geo-location, and local event data.
- Implementation Steps:
- Implement event-driven architecture to process streaming data in real time.
- Dynamically adjust recommendations based on current supply and demand.
- Tools: Apache Kafka and AWS Kinesis provide robust, scalable streaming data platforms.
- Business Impact: Maximizes fleet utilization and customer satisfaction during peak periods or special events.
5. Market and Customer Segmentation: Fine-Tuning Recommendations by Group
- Data Required: Rental trends, demographic data, local traffic patterns, and rental purposes per city.
- Implementation Steps:
- Develop detailed customer personas and segment markets accordingly.
- Customize recommendation rules and vehicle prioritization per segment.
- Tools: CRM platforms like Salesforce and HubSpot offer advanced segmentation and behavioral analytics.
- Business Impact: Enhances relevance and booking rates by addressing locality and customer diversity.

8. A/B Testing: Validating and Refining Your Recommendation System
- Data Required: Defined KPIs such as conversion rate, average booking value, and engagement metrics.
- Implementation Steps:
- Design controlled experiments comparing different algorithms or UI variants.
- Analyze results statistically to identify winning approaches.
- Implement successful strategies and iterate continuously.
- Tools: Google Optimize and Optimizely simplify experiment management and analysis.
- Business Impact: Ensures data-driven improvements, maximizing return on recommendation system investments.

Key Metrics to Measure Your Recommendation System’s Success
| Strategy | What to Measure | How to Track |
|---|---|---|
| Collaborative Filtering | Click-through rate (CTR), booking rate | Analytics on clicks and conversions from recommended vehicles |
| Content-Based Filtering | Precision, recall, booking alignment | Compare recommended vehicle features to actual bookings |
| Hybrid Models | Overall accuracy, revenue uplift | A/B testing results and revenue tracking |
| Real-Time Personalization | Booking velocity during events, response time | Monitor booking spikes and system latency |
| Market Segmentation | Customer retention, segment-specific bookings | CRM reports and segment analysis |
| Customer Feedback | Net Promoter Score (NPS), satisfaction ratings | Survey analytics from Zigpoll or similar tools |
| UI/UX Optimization | Engagement rate, bounce rate | User behavior analytics on apps and websites |
| A/B Testing | KPI improvements (conversion, revenue) | Statistical analysis of experiment data |

Frequently Asked Questions About Car Rental Recommendation Systems
What is a recommendation system in car rentals?
A recommendation system analyzes customer data and preferences to suggest car rental options tailored to individual users and local market conditions.
How do recommendation systems improve car rental sales?
They reduce decision fatigue by presenting relevant vehicle options aligned with customer preferences and market trends, leading to higher booking conversions and customer loyalty.
Can recommendation systems be customized for different city markets?
Yes. By incorporating market segmentation and local data, these systems personalize recommendations to specific city preferences, inventory, and trends.
What types of data are essential for building an effective recommendation system?
Key data includes rental history, vehicle attributes, customer demographics and preferences, real-time inventory, and customer feedback.
How do I measure the effectiveness of a recommendation system?
